How Hybridge SBA Loans Work

Hybridge offers SBA loans to small businesses that are looking to grow or expand. These loans are guaranteed by the U.S. Small Business Administration, which means that they come with lower interest rates and more flexible repayment terms than traditional loans.

The loan amount can range from $50,000 to $5 million, with a repayment period of up to 25 years, depending on the loan type. Interest rates are competitive and vary depending on the loan amount, the repayment period, and the borrower’s creditworthiness.

Application Process

The application process for a Hybridge SBA loan is more involved than the application process for a traditional loan. Borrowers are required to provide detailed information about their business, including financial statements, tax returns, and a business plan. Once the application is approved, the funds are typically available within a few weeks.

Benefits and Drawbacks

One of the main benefits of Hybridge SBA loans is the lower interest rates and more flexible repayment terms. These loans can provide small businesses with the financing they need to grow and expand. Additionally, the SBA loan program is backed by the government, which means that borrowers may be able to access more capital than they would with a traditional loan.

However, the application process for SBA loans can be time-consuming and complex. Borrowers are required to provide detailed information about their business, and the approval process can take several weeks. Additionally, the loan amount may not be sufficient for borrowers who require larger sums of money.
